Valsartan and hydrochlorothiazide tablets may cause serious side effects including: • Harm to an unborn baby causing injury and even death. See “What is the most important information I should know about valsartan and hydrochlorothiazide tablets?” • Low blood pressure (hypotension). Low blood pressure is most likely to happen if you: otake water pills oare on a low-salt diet oget dialysis treatments ohave heart problems oget sick with vomiting or diarrhea odrink alcohol Lie down if you feel faint or dizzy. Call your doctor right away. • Allergic reactions. People with and without allergy problems or asthma who take valsartan and hydrochlorothiazide tablets may get allergic reactions. • Worsening of Lupus. Hydrochlorothiazide, one of the medicines in valsartan and hydrochlorothiazide tablets may cause Lupus to become active or worse. • Fluid and electrolyte (salt) problems. Tell your doctor about any of the following signs and symptoms of fluid and electrolyte problems: dry mouthdrowsinessmuscle fatiguethirstrestlessnessvery low urine outputlack of energy (lethargic)confusionfast heartbeatweaknessseizuresnausea and vomitingmuscle pain or cramps • • • • • • • • • • • • • • Kidney problems. Kidney problems may become worse in people that already have kidney disease. Some people will have changes on blood tests for kidney function and may need a lower dose of valsartan and hydrochlorothiazide tablets. Call your doctor if you get swelling in your feet, ankles, or hands, or unexplained weight gain. If you have heart failure, your doctor should check your kidney function before prescribing valsartan and hydrochlorothiazide tablets. • Skin rash. Call your doctor right away if you have an unusual skin rash. • Eye problems. One of the medicines in valsartan and hydrochlorothiazide tablets can cause eye problems that may lead to vision loss. Symptoms of eye problems can happen within hours to weeks of starting valsartan and hydrochlorothiazide tablets. Tell your doctor right away if you have: •decrease in vision •eye pain Protect your skin from the sun and undergo regular skin cancer screening, as one of the medicines in valsartan and hydrochlorothiazide tablets may cause non-melanoma skin cancer. Other side effects were generally mild and brief. They generally have not caused patients to stop taking valsartan and hydrochlorothiazide tablets. Tell your doctor if you have any side effect that bothers you or that does not go away. These are not all the possible side effects of valsartan and hydrochlorothiazide tablets. How do I store valsartan and hydrochlorothiazide tablets? •Store valsartan and hydrochlorothiazide tablets at room temperature between 59oF to 86oF (15oC to 30oC). •Keep valsartan and hydrochlorothiazide tablets in a closed container in a dry place. Keep valsartan and hydrochlorothiazide tablets and all medicines out of the reach of children.
